Transaction 3f41d63f24ae6195a11420c3072865a28360452f53b8f54080c93f16f195365b

1 Input
2 Outputs
  • 3f41d63f24ae6195a11420c3072865a28360452f53b8f54080c93f16f195365b:0
  • value  5099502
    address  2N2gMtHt94A168NfZRVnKYcFsjqodSVZkf6
  • 3f41d63f24ae6195a11420c3072865a28360452f53b8f54080c93f16f195365b:1
  • value  1000000
    address  2N5vpE5aL3CpaPCDwYXW8MT6bxk8Ztjx8Jr